6 EASY ENROLLMENT STEPS

1. Apply: Complete a Mt. SAC Application for Admission (available online and in the Schedule of Classes). Send or bring it to the Admissions & Records Office. You must submit official transcripts fro all accredited, high schools, colleges and trade schools attended. A permit to register will be mailed to you. It will tell you your assigned registration date and time.

2. Get Assessed: Schedule and take your course placement tests at the Assessment Center on campus. Call (909) 594-5611, ext. 4265. Most classes have basic skill prerequisites that must be assessed prior to registration. You must complete your assessment after your application for admission has been processed and before your orientation and registration date.

3. Attend Orientation: Attend an orientation session. Both new students and first-time transfer students from other colleges must attend orientation before registering for classes unless otherwise exempted. To schedule an appointment, call ext. 5913.

4. Get Counseled and Advised: Our trained counselors can help you if you:

  • Don’t have a major or are undecided about a career choice
  • Need help with vocational/career plans
  • Need to choose a university or college for transfer
  • Have personal problems that impact your college success

Call the Counseling Center at ext. 4380.

Our advisors can help you if you:

  • Need information on course selection
  • Need to identify the classes you need for an Associate degree or certificate
  • Need help with your education plan
  • Need general information about the College

Call the Advising Center at ext. 4293.

5. Register: You can register online or by phone: (909) 595-6722. Before you do, we suggest that you:

  • Prepare a tentative class schedule using your Schedule Planning Worksheet provided in your printed Schedule of Classes.
  • Check for course prerequisites and corequisites, making sure you have satisfied the requirements.
  • Register for required corequisites (courses that must be taken during the same term as the courses originally chosen)

6. Pay Your Fees: If you register by telephone or in person, fees must be paid within seven business days from the day you registered. You may make your payment by credit card through Telephone Registration, by mail, by drop box, online or in person.
